Turtle Flambeau Fishing Report10-03-12

By Professional Guide Jerry Hartigan

So far this week the walleye bite on the Flowage has been really good.  The fish are in their fall patterns and have moved into deeper water.  As I said in my last report, the bigger fish seemed to be a little shallower in around 16 feet.

Today I went out with very high expectations; a big cold front forecast to move in within a couple of days and seeing lots of deer, grouse, and turkeys feeding on the way to the boat launch.  As it turned out we did not have the day I was expecting.  We managed to find some fish with only four keepers, but they were very spread out with no spots holding more than a few fish. 

Most of the walleye were found in 15 to 20 feet along with some perch.  I only had a half day so I did not get to search very far for fish.  I was also out half the night last night tracking a deer my brother shot with his bow so that was my excuse for not having a good day. 

Luckily my wife Christa was with helping because she found the deer with no blood trail by figuring out which way the deer was most likely to go after it was hit.  I will let you know how the rest of the week goes.
